Consider carefully your borrowing from the bank

“It is a good idea to test your own ratings to your True Credit otherwise Borrowing from the bank Karma just to make certain that when you have one errors, one discrepancies, people swindle [or] any big warning flags,” told you Dolly Perkins, broker at Realty off Maine from inside the Dover-Foxcroft. “A few of these credit bureaus will say to you precisely what does perhaps not look good on your report and you will target people circumstances.”

Odom said that, fundamentally, the minimum credit rating for anyone finding a home is be accessible 640, though specific lenders is certainly going straight down according to your own certificates. You may need to do a little work with their credit before you are prepared to order a home.

“Usually, in the event the financing is actually refuted it’s on account of borrowing from the bank,” Odom said. “My suggestions in https://speedycashloan.net/loans/debt-consolidation/ terms of borrowing was every person should have some sort of tradelines that will be revealing in order to borrowing from the bank – car finance, unsecured loan, education loan, mastercard – essentially two or three acounts revealing credit is better.”

Matter their savings

If at all possible, you should have some cash for a downpayment, or even the upfront commission on our home will set you back. The conventional understanding should be to put down 20 percent of one’s residence’s cost, however, many financing will need a lesser amount of. Specific financing none of them a downpayment anyway.

“it all depends on what sorts of financial a purchaser qualifies to possess,” Lane said. “Low income outlying development demands zero downpayment, however, hefty closing prices charges from the provider.”

Even though you aren’t to make big down-payment, although, you will have some money spared getting moving costs and you will emergencies.

“Good guideline would be to have a good three to half a year out of discounts in your membership in case anything goes – when you have a short-term lay off, when your heater goes out, when your hot water tank stops working,” Perkins said. “You need to anticipate the fresh unforeseen.”

Possess some experience (otherwise see whom to call)

When you own property, you are assuming the maintenance commitments one to a landlord would generally speaking care for if perhaps you were leasing. With some basic restoration knowledge is an important part of house control – especially as it can truly add on pricing if you have to engage somebody whenever some thing easy requires doing..

“Simple things like area away from liquid valves, electronic committee shut down, heating system shut off should all end up being identified,” Way told you. “Color, removing old wallpaper, setting up hardwood floors, plumbing system – if a homeowner has the skills to do it accurately, this new return on the investment is actually much higher.”

The greatest experience you can get try understanding how to correctly clean the elements of your home, from the tub along with your gutters to all or any filters to your the products. As well as, you need to be capable tell if your own sink and rooftop was dripping, learn to be sure new color try handled right up therefore, the timber will not decompose and continue maintaining an eye fixed out for other regular fix conditions that might result.

Perkins along with considered determine what repair is needed to possess their variety of home. Does it want turf fix? Really does your residence keeps a pool? Does it have a beneficial septic program? Do you have the skills in order to services a furnace, otherwise change water filter systems?

“Understanding how to clean securely most likely the most significant situation,” Perkins said. “Clutter was unsafe. They devalues possessions. Focusing and never permitting [maintenance] get off your is the greatest thing you can do.”
